How much do volunteer in pharmacy jobs pay per hour?

As of Jun 8, 2026, the average hourly pay for volunteer in pharmacy in the United States is $19.14,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$14.42 and $20.19 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Volunteer In Pharmacy vs Pharmacy Technician?

AspectVolunteer In PharmacyPharmacy Technician
Required CredentialsNo formal certification required; may need basic trainingCertification or registration often required, depending on state
Work EnvironmentHospitals, community pharmacies, clinics, often unpaidLicensed pharmacy settings, paid position
Employer & Industry UsageHospitals, pharmacies, healthcare facilities, volunteer organizationsRetail pharmacies, hospitals, long-term care facilities

Volunteer In Pharmacy roles typically involve unpaid assistance, focusing on supporting pharmacy staff and gaining experience. Pharmacy Technicians are paid professionals with formal training and certification, responsible for dispensing medications and managing pharmacy operations. Both roles operate in similar environments, but the Technician role requires specific credentials and offers a career pathway, while volunteering provides valuable exposure and community service experience.

Job Overview:

The Pharmacy Resident achieves objectives and competencies for each rotation in accordance with ASHP standards for residents in pharmacy practice. The Pharmacy Resident actively participates in patient care and ensures that medications are provided in a safe and rational manner. Any and all requirements of MMC employment will be met. In addition, the resident will conduct an independent research project. This project will be presented at the per year residency conference. Staffing in the pharmacy department is also required as needed by the determination of the pharmacy management team.

Qualifications:

Required:

  • Completion of course at an accredited School of Pharmacy, with a degree of Bachelor of Science in Pharmacy or PharmD.
  • Must be a MATCHED candidate through ASHP NMS program
  • NJ State License due within two (2) months of start date
  • Hospital pharmacy experience desirable
  • Understanding of the role of the pharmacy department within the hospital, its interrelationships with other departments and functions.
  • Successful completion of all orientations

Scheduling Requirements:

  • Day Shift
  • Full-Time
  • 40 hours per week

Essential Functions:

  • Assumes role of drug information provided to all members of the healthcare team specific to patient populations and age groups
  • Monitors specific medication prescribing in accordance with established drug usage criteria, prior to dispensing, as defined by the Pharmacy & Therapeutics Committee
  • Provides four (4) clinical presentations per year (e.g. journal article review, drug review, etc.
  • Enhances professional growth and development through participation in educational programs, current literature, workshops, in-service meetings, etc.
  • Oversees preparing of parental admixtures, dispensing, and compounding of medications
  • Provides educational rotation for pharmacy students as required
  • Meets progression standards of ASHP Residency Program
  • Oversees the dispensing of medications as it relates to filling Pyxis, Unit Dosing and Patient's own medications
  • Utilizes the medication screening process to insure medication orders are complete, appropriate, within legal parameters and prioritized
